Ofrenda de Dia de Muertos Exhibit at Roberta’s Art Gallery

Celebrate the souls of departed loved ones through a cultural display at the “Ofrenda de Día de Muertos” exhibit at Roberta’s Art Gallery. This display is carefully curated by the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ater’s Spanish Club and Latinos Unidos student organizations. It will be on display from Oct. 28 to Saturday, Nov. 2.

“Ofrenda de Día de Muertos” is an exhibit honoring Día de Muertos, or “Day of the Dead,” in English. This exhibit will feature an interactive altar, or “ofrenda,” where the Whitewater campus and community can write the name of a past loved one and leave behind significant items to welcome and honor their departed family members and friends. Throughout Mexico, families create elaborate celebrations of life involving small offerings and objects of remembrance to warmly invite the souls of the dead back to life’s celebrations.
